"I'm a Little Teapot" was written by Clarence Kelley and George Sanders in 1939. It is a popular nursery rhyme and children's song.

The Teapot Dome scandal was the symbol of corruption in the Harding Administration. It involved government officials illegally leasing government oil reserves to private oil companies in exchange for bribes and kickbacks. This scandal tarnished Harding's presidency and led to several convictions of government officials involved.
